Position Summary: ultra focused - Work together to fearlessly uncover new possibilities Reporting to the Director, Quality Control Operations, the Senior Manager, QC Operations and Stability will perform quality control functions supporting drug substance, drug product and cell banks. This individual with collaborate with cross functional stakeholders and externally with contract manufacturing facilities. Work Model: Core Lab & Ops: This role typically requires that the majority of the work be conducted on-site and thus will be subject to certain on-site safety protocols during the pandemic. Responsibilities: Evaluate product stability data to establish and extend product shelf-life. Assure ongoing readiness for regulatory inspection; participate in audits and inspections. Create and improve procedures. Support Regulatory submissions (e.g, INDs, BLAs), coordinate data requests, compilation and management of externally generated data Ensures appropriate data integrity controls/ALCOA/data integrity issues for system requirements. Generation of Certificate of Analysis Serve as a technical lead for management of Quality Records: Global application of root cause, deviations, impact assessments, complex investigations in collaboration with other departments. Provide hands-on leadership for the QC Operations oversight of the group, data review, schedule and training.
